Boosting Bounce Back: Collagen and Elastin for Youthful Skin
As we grow older, our skin's natural production of collagen and elastin reduces. These essential proteins provide the skin with its firmness, elasticity, and youthful appearance. Consequently, wrinkles, creases, and sagging can appear. Thankfully, there are ways to support collagen and elastin production, assisting you achieve that coveted youthful look.
One effective approach is to incorporate collagen-rich foods into your diet. These comprise bone broth, fish skin, and eggshells.

Hydration Heroes : Supporting Skin Elasticity Through Hydration
Achieving healthy skin is a quest many folks embark on. A crucial factor of this journey lies in enhancing skin elasticity, which allows our skin to rebound from daily wear and tear. While genetics play a role, external factors like sun exposure and free radicals can diminish our skin's natural elasticity over time. Fortunately, there are effective tools in our arsenal to combat this: moisturizers.
Strategic hydration is the foundation of supple, elastic skin. Moisturizers work by drawing humidity from the air and locking it into the epidermis, keeping your skin hydrated. Choosing a moisturizer rich in hydrating agents is essential to absorb water and keep optimal moisture levels.
